Introduction to Hacktool Win32

Hacktool Win32 is a category of malware that encompasses a wide range of tools used for hacking and cracking purposes. These tools are designed to exploit vulnerabilities in software, bypass security features, and gain unauthorized access to computer systems. The term “Win32” specifically refers to the Windows 32-bit operating system architecture, indicating that these tools are primarily designed to target Windows-based computers.

Understanding the Role of MSR

MSR stands for Model-Specific Register, which is a component of the CPU (Central Processing Unit) architecture. Model-Specific Registers are used to control various aspects of CPU operation, including power management, performance monitoring, and security features. In the context of Hacktool Win32 cracking MSR, the malware targets these registers to manipulate the CPU’s behavior, allowing it to bypass security mechanisms and execute malicious code.

How is Hacktool Win32 Cracking MSR distributed and what are the common infection vectors?

Hacktool Win32 Cracking MSR is typically distributed through various channels, including but not limited to, peer-to-peer file sharing networks, infected software downloads, and malicious websites. The tool can also be spread via email attachments or links that, when opened, download and install the malware on the victim’s computer. Additionally, visiting compromised websites or clicking on malicious advertisements can lead to the unintentional download of Hacktool Win32 Cracking MSR.

The common infection vectors for Hacktool Win32 Cracking MSR include drive-by downloads, where visiting a malicious website results in the automatic download of the malware, and social engineering tactics, where users are tricked into downloading the tool under the guise of a legitimate software or update. It’s essential for users to practice caution when downloading software from the internet, ensure that their antivirus software is up-to-date, and avoid engaging with suspicious emails or websites to minimize the risk of infection.

How do I remove Hacktool Win32 Cracking MSR from my system if I suspect an infection?

If a system is suspected to be infected with Hacktool Win32 Cracking MSR, the first step is to disconnect from the internet to prevent any further malicious activity. Next, enter the system’s safe mode to limit the malware’s ability to operate. Then, use an up-to-date antivirus software to perform a full system scan, which should detect and remove the malware. It’s also recommended to check for and remove any suspicious programs or applications that were installed without authorization.

In some cases, manual removal may be necessary, which involves identifying and deleting the malware’s files and registry entries. This process requires caution and a good understanding of system operations to avoid causing unintended damage. After removal, it’s crucial to change all passwords, especially for sensitive accounts, and to monitor the system for any signs of reinfection. Regular system backups should also be checked for malware to ensure that backup files are not compromised. If the infection is severe or if the user is not confident in their ability to remove the malware, seeking the assistance of a professional may be the best course of action to ensure complete removal and system security.
